In 69 I ordered a Cuda-blue b5- automatic-fastback no 4 speed offered black deluxe interior put a$1000.00 outrageous deposit on it finally dealer told me they were changing to the 70 E body and building no more A bodies and would either refund or put the deposit on a 70 440 car. Went back and forth over the sale finally the salesman found one that had been ordered and never finalized the sale. The car I got is a brown coupe black-cheap interior 440 Cuda and $200 off of the original deal. I was barely able to pay the payments back then but now it is worth quite a bit more than the original price. You guys need to quit whining about”HOW EXPENSIVE” these cars have become.
